Global Smart Meters Market Statistics, Outlook and Regional Analysis 2025-2033

The global smart meters market size was valued at USD 26.7 Billion in 2024, and it is expected to reach USD 50.3 Billion by 2033, exhibiting a growth rate (CAGR) of 7.24% from 2025 to 2033.

The global smart meters market is driven by the surging need for more efficient energy management and sustainable solutions. Utilities across the globe are increasingly adopting smart meters to address growing demands for energy and water conservation and to reduce waste. According to the International Energy Agency (IEA), global electricity demand is expected to grow by an average of 3.4% annually through 2026, driven by emerging and developing economies.  Smart meters enable real-time monitoring, helping utilities manage demand, detect outages, and prevent energy theft, which can significantly impact utility revenues.  Besides this, governments are also incentivizing smart meter installations to support their sustainability goals, which is aiding in market expansion.

Concurrently, smart meters play a critical role in integrating renewable energy sources into grids by facilitating two-way communication, which allows consumers to contribute energy back into the grid, a crucial step as global renewable energy capacity expands. The IEA projects that renewables will generate about 50% of global electricity by 2030 and 80% by 2050, driven by solar photovoltaic (PV) and wind. Moreover, developing regions are also experiencing rapid adoption of smart meters. In China, the government’s emphasis on grid modernization and initiatives like the State Grid Corporation of China's (SGCC) rollout has resulted in tens of millions of installations, creating a positive outlook for the market expansion. In addition to this, the continuous rollout of smart city initiatives worldwide is further bolstering the demand for advanced metering solutions. Along with this, with the rising consumer awareness and a shift towards data-driven energy management, these developments are fueling the demand for smart meters. Furthermore, significant advancements in the Internet of Things (IoT) and big data analytics technologies enhancing the value of smart meters, thereby offering granular insights into consumption patterns that drive efficient use and energy savings for consumers are impelling the market growth. Apart from this, the integration of fifth-generation (5G) networks supporting higher data transmission rates for smart meters and providing a scalable infrastructure for rapid data processing essential in large-scale smart grid implementations are propelling the market forward.

Global Smart Meters Market Statistics, By Region

The market research report has also provided a comprehensive analysis of all the major regional markets, which include North America (the United States and Canada); Asia-Pacific (China, Japan, India, South Korea, Australia, Indonesia, and others); Europe (Germany, France, the United Kingdom, Italy, Spain, Russia, and others); Latin America (Brazil, Mexico, and others); and the Middle East and Africa. According to the report, Asia-Pacific accounted for the largest market share on account of rapid urbanization, government initiatives, and large-scale grid modernization.

North America Smart Meters Market Trends:

The region's demand for smart meters is driven by regulatory mandates promoting advanced metering infrastructure and federal programs supporting smart grid developments. Investments in upgrading aging grid systems and integrating renewable energy sources are central to the increasing adoption of smart metering technology in North America.

Asia-Pacific Smart Meters Market Trends:

The demand for smart meters in Asia Pacific is being driven by the region’s expanding focus on sustainable energy initiatives and growing electricity consumption fueled by economic growth. Nations such as India and Indonesia are investing heavily in smart grid technologies to reduce energy losses, which the International Energy Agency notes can reach up to 20% in some areas. The region’s significant investments in renewable energy infrastructure further push the adoption of smart meters to support efficient energy distribution. According to the Asian Development Bank, renewable energy investment in Asia-Pacific is projected to exceed $1.3 trillion by 2030, enhancing grid reliability.

Europe Smart Meters Market Trends:

Demand in Europe is propelled by strong legislative frameworks promoting energy efficiency, such as the EU’s Green Deal, aiming for a carbon-neutral economy by 2050. Extensive rollout programs backed by governments ensure widespread adoption supported by consumer awareness of sustainable energy management.

Latin America Smart Meters Market Trends:

The need for better energy distribution and revenue protection is propelling demand in Latin America. Smart meters help combat energy theft and technical losses, which are notably high in countries like Brazil.

Middle East and Africa Smart Meters Market Trends:

Smart meter demand here is fueled by growing urbanization and infrastructure development in line with national visions like Saudi Arabia’s Vision 2030. Investments in improving electricity supply reliability and reducing losses are key, as governments push for better energy management solutions.

  • In February 2024, Rhode Island Energy partnered with Landis+Gyr to deploy and support advanced smart metering technology for 530,000 electric customers in the state. The agreement includes the installation of Landis+Gyr's Revelo metering platform, which features grid-edge sensing and edge computing capabilities to manage load and support grid troubleshooting.
  • In September 2023, Itron, a leading energy and water management company, is partnering with Jordan Electric Power Company (JEPCO) to advance its digital transformation. JEPCO will use Itron Enterprise Edition™ (IEE) Meter Data Management (MDM) to streamline business operations and centralize data management. The MDM will enable JEPCO to manage data from over 1.5 million smart meters, with the capability to manage an additional 100,000 meters per year over the next five years.


Global Smart Meters Market Segmentation Coverage

  • On the basis of the product, the market has been categorized into smart electricity, smart water, and smart gas meters, wherein smart electricity meter represents the leading segment due to its crucial role in enabling efficient energy management and real-time monitoring of electricity usage. Utilities prioritize smart electricity meters to reduce operational costs, improve outage detection, and support demand response programs, meeting the growing need for accurate billing and enhanced grid reliability.
  • Based on the technology, the market is bifurcated into AMI (advanced metering infrastructure) and AMR (automatic meter reading), amongst which AMI (advanced metering infrastructure) dominates the market. AMI leads the market as it offers comprehensive two-way communication, allowing utilities to remotely monitor, control, and optimize energy distribution. This technology supports data-driven decision-making and proactive grid management, enhancing energy efficiency and aligning with smart grid initiatives globally.
  • On the basis of the end use, the market has been divided into residential, commercial, and industrial. The rising consumer interest in managing energy costs and sustainable living practices is boosting smart meter installations in households. In addition to this, businesses are adopting smart meters to optimize energy consumption, reduce utility expenses, and meet regulatory requirements for energy efficiency. Furthermore, industries seek smart meters to enhance energy management, support predictive maintenance, and increase operational efficiency for better production output.
